Following the principle of abstraction implies separating the behavior of software components from their implementation.
SUBSCRIBE --> https://www.youtube.com/user/rithustutorials?sub_confirmation=1 RECOMMENDED COURSE - Your … The design step in developing software has some unique characteristics. this phase proceeds at a high level of abstraction with respect to the …
Share on. Authors: Jeff Kramer. As in other engineering professions, software engineers rely on tools. Learn Software Design as an Abstraction from University of Colorado System. The principle of abstraction is another specialization of the principle of separation of concerns. An example of a procedural abstraction would be the word open for a door. While many tools today are applied to find new defects in old code, I predict that more software-engineering tools of the future will be available to software … The next level would be a handful of components, and so on, while the lowest level could be millions of objects. ... click to visit Physical Science and Engineering page Physical Science and Engineering.
First of all, it’s the only step where drawing pictures of things is the norm. See abstraction layer . ... is the specification of the interaction between a system and its environment. The role of abstraction in software engineering. Software engineering is an engineering branch associated with development of software product using well-defined scientific principles, methods and procedures. Home Conferences ICSE Proceedings ICSE '06 The role of abstraction in software engineering. F. Tsui, A. Gharaat, S. Duggins and E. Jung, “Measuring Levels of Abstraction in Software Development”, Internal Research Report, Software Engineering… Y. Wang, “A Hierarchical Abstraction Model for Software Engineering,” 2nd International Workshop on Role of Abstraction in Software Engineering, Leipzig, Germany, May, 2008. ARTICLE . The outcome of software engineering is an efficient and reliable software product. Software Design - What is Abstraction? Free Access. It requires learning to look at software and software … Such tools can analyze program texts and design specifications more automatically and in more detail than ever before.
This Design Pattern is a method to solve this problem: imagine that you’ve got to represent in a program a book and to check all of its copied for a library for example, so you’ve to … Imperial … Abstraction is the process of hiding complex properties or characteristics from the software itself to keep things more simplistic.
The highest level of abstraction is the entire system.
A procedural abstraction is a named sequence of instructions that has a specific and limited function.
in Software Engineering, which is a volume of the Computing Curricula Series published in August 23, 2004, it is explained that: Software engineering differs from traditional engineering because of the special nature of software, which places a greater emphasis on abstraction… Software Engineering | Software Design Process.
Axs Alicia Keys, Lisa Dance Solo, Norman Reedus Movies, Chrissy Teigen Firefighter, The Pilgrim Project, Trash Humpers Nihilism, John Swartzwelder Ron Swanson, Frank Dillman Actor, Gonna Love Me Lyrics, Patti Smith Husband Death, December 10 ‑ John Cena, Halo Reach Mcc Release Date, Electric Love Festival 2019, Buy Overwatch Key, Miami Vice Font Generator, Linear Regression Equation Calculator, Children Of The Corn: Genesis Ending Explained, Moment Js Compare Dates, Abraham Benrubi Twister, Chris Kläfford - Wicked Game, Life-size 2 Dvd Release Date, Kim Kardashian Property, Dodgers Depth Chart, Ann Arbor Weather, Outdoor Lights Home Depot, Youngest Navy Seal, Ali Wong Las Vegas, Patrizio Bertelli Linkedin, Build Me Up Buttercup Chords, Top 50 Richest People In The World, Mark Metcalf Movies, Sean Mcnamara Movies, Jeezy Net Worth 2019 Forbes, Jeezy Net Worth 2019 Forbes, Irina Shayk And Gaga, Damon Dash And Jay-z, Carol Alt Age, Mark Jackson Jr Mo'nique Son, Johnny Mercer Personality, Briana Latrise Isaacs Fight With Egypt, Pressure Formula Units, Deborah Shiling Messing Age, Repel Windproof Travel Umbrella, Shout, Sister, Shout Book, Virgen Del Rosario Del Pozo, Frankenstein Chapter 1-9 Summary, Old Friends Senior Dog Sanctuary Captain Ron, Glee Cast Talks About The Quarterback Episode, Station 19 Season 3 Episode 3, Stream Seinfeld Festivus, Burberry Net Worth, Eric Williams 2020, Jordan Maron Abs, Billy Campbell Melrose Place, Colleen Atwood Snow White And The Huntsman Costumes,